3 minutes ago, jj51702 said:
Have u asked erdogan how much experience he has with Afro textured hair? Going from memory I’ve only seen one case of his published online on Afro hair. As you may already know, Afro textured hair typically has a strong curl underneath the skin which makes it difficult to extract with fue. Not trying to scare you or anything but just saying it’s best to be cautious.
I’m sure there was a guy recently with Afro hair who went to Asmed and created a thread. I can’t remember his name of the top of my head though.

5 hours ago, CosmoKramer said:
14th month post FUE procedure w/Dr Erdogan & ASMED
How fast time has gone by its crazy but I’m even more happy with my progress/results at this point...for full transparency I’ve added microneedling & Minoxidil & Nizoral a little after my 11th month post HT and I can’t say for certainty whether my improvement is due to natural maturing of the transplanted hairs or new growth or due to the microneedling & Minoxidil & Nizoral routine but I believe it’s the latter as my crown has filled in nicely in areas where there were no transplanted hairs.
1st 3 photos are from today post gym workout and ball cap hair and hair is about 2-inches in length on top, have not got it cut since last haircut/fade early last month. Last photo is from May 6th (almost 11th month and prior to my new routine)
